Daily Habits That Preserve Your Floors' Beauty


A big part of hardwood floor care is consistency. Day-to-day tasks such as strolling with wet shoes or dragging furnishings can speed up deterioration. It's outstanding how much of a difference small modifications can make. Something as basic as leaving shoes at the door or sweeping with a soft broom every night can extend the life of your floor's finish.


It's also important to take care of dampness meticulously. Timber and water have a challenging connection. A moist wipe could appear like the best tool, yet excessive water can seep right into seams and cause swelling or buckling gradually. A slightly wet microfiber mop is a better choice-- and if you're in a location like San Jose, where coastal air can be damp, maintaining humidity levels regular indoors is equally as vital.


Seasonal Changes and How to Handle Them


Seasonal shifts often imply modifications in humidity and temperature level, which hardwood floors reply to more than a lot of realize. You may see your flooring increasing slightly in the summertime and having in the winter season. These fluctuations are regular, but if they're as well severe, voids or twisting can take place.


Installing a humidifier in the winter season or making use of a dehumidifier throughout the summer assists support the indoor environment. This is especially practical after a hardwood floor installation in Santa Clara, where you want to protect your investment from early ecological tension.


Managing Scratches and Dullness properly


In time, small scratches and scuffs are inevitable. The secret is to resolve them before they grow or collect. If you have family pets or often reposition furnishings, you'll see even more indications of surface wear. Felt pads under furniture legs can protect against much of these issues, but what about the marks that already exist?


Light scrapes can typically be buffed out with a touch-up pen or wood repair work set. For dullness, using a flooring polish that's suitable with your surface can recover some of the initial luster. Long-Term Maintenance: When and How to Refinish


Every floor gets to a point where standard cleansing no more revitalizes its look. That's where refinishing is available in. This process involves fining sand down the surface area to eliminate old finishes and afterwards applying a brand-new safety coat. Relying on the wear and kind of timber, floors can typically be refinished every 7 to 10 years.

Creating a Floor-Friendly Home Environment


Furniture design, lights, carpets, and even curtains all play a role in the wellness of your wood floorings. UV rays from direct sunlight can cause fading or discoloration. Area rugs secure your floor covering from foot website traffic, but they also enable you to style your home in innovative methods. Just make sure they're not rubber-backed, as these can trap wetness or leave residue.
